{"data":{"fields":"term_definition","term_definition":"<div class=\"definition\">The path of the instantaneous points of contact on the surface of a gear tooth. This term has been used in the past for path of action and length of action. A study of the events in the engagement of spur gear teeth is the simplest way to examine gear tooth action. As the driving member rotates and its teeth engage with the driven member, the first point of contact is in the flank of the driver and at the tip of the driven. As rotation proceeds, succeeding points of contact proceed from the flank of the driver to the pitch circle and then outward to the tip of the driving member. On the driven member contact proceeds inward from the tip of the tooth to the pitch circle and then to the flank where the contact ceases when the next engaging pair of teeth begin contact. The summation of all the points of contact for zero load condition is the path of contact. The shape of the path of contact curve is dependent on the tooth profile curves and the general direction of the path of contact is dependent on the pressure angle. For plane involute gear tooth profiles, the path of contact is a straight line and is called line of action. The path of contact, as seen from the above description of tooth engagement, may be separated into two parts relative to the pitch circle. Considering the driving member as contact begins in the flank and proceeds to the pitch circle the action is termed approach action. Then as contact proceeds from the pitch circle outward to the tip of the tooth, the action is termed recess action. The sum of approach and recess action is the path of contact.
